Putin: Navalny wanted to be detained

Alexey Navalny’s oppositionist realized that he violates Russian legislation, and deliberately walked to be detained on his return to Russia, President Vladimir Putin said at a press conference on the results of negotiations with US President Joe Biden, Interfax reports.

“Regarding our non-systemic opposition and a citizen who mentioned. The first one, this man knew that the law was violated in Russia,” said Russian leader.

Putin reminded that Navalny “was obliged to be celebrated as a person, twice convicted to stately punishment, consciously, I want to emphasize this, ignoring this requirement of the law, this gentleman drove abroad for treatment.”

“did not require the authorities for registration. As soon as he left the hospital and posted his videos on the Internet, such a requirement arose. He did not appear, ignored the demand of the law. He was announced wanted,” the Russian president continued.

“knowing about it, he came. Occurs from what he wanted, deliberately walked to be detained. He did what he wanted, so what can we talk about?” – Putin added.
